Canggu (pronounced Chang-goo) is the smaller, surfer-and-digital-nomad-leaning area 8 km north of Seminyak that has overtaken its older neighbour as Bali's coolest neighbourhood since around 2018. Three main areas: Echo Beach, Berawa, and the centre around Batu Bolong. Each has consistent surf breaks, healthy-eating cafes, design boutiques, and a relaxed scene that mixes long-term Western residents with Balinese families.
Standout Canggu spots: La Brisa Beach Club (rustic-luxe beach bar), Crate Cafe (the original digital nomad cafe), Tanah Barak Beach (surf and sunset), and the Wednesday and Sunday Old Man's beach parties. Surf lessons from 350000 IDR per session. A 15-minute Grab ride from Seminyak costs around 60000 IDR. Many Seminyak visitors do a half-day in Canggu mid-trip then return.
Pro Tip: Visit Canggu on a Wednesday or Sunday for the Old Man's beach pool party (free entry, drinks from 60000 IDR). The Berawa rice fields walk at the back of the area is the photogenic green-rice landscape most visitors miss.
